Abstract

This study presents an efficient method for synthesizing triaryl-substituted acyclic olefins, employing palladium-catalyzed diarylation of primary C(sp3)─H bonds at the γ-position of 2-(2-phenylpropyl)pyridine derivatives, using halogen-substituted aryl boronic esters as coupling reagents. Intramolecular β-hydride elimination plays a key role in facilitating the formation of these compounds. The diarylation reaction proceeds smoothly with high functional group tolerance and good yields, even on a gram scale. Preliminary mechanistic studies suggest that the reaction may proceed through a Pd(II)/Pd(IV) catalytic cycle. This approach offers a novel strategy for the one-pot synthesis of triaryl-substituted acyclic olefin derivatives.
